typo during last post..after reset..had a few run full cycle test charge.. seems like no auto shut down occur anymore..

delete few battery eater apps..viber, facebook messenger, wechat..
minimize sync to google email and contacts only..
connected to GSM network only during sleep time..

wallah.. my battery just drop 2-3% overnight.. yeay! thumbup.gif

Thanks to all for advice.. now my battery life and cycle seems more stable..
